St. Teresa is right on the Gulf of Mexico, but is protected by a sandspit which extends from Alligator Point, so the waves are always gentle. This makes it perfect for swimming, fishing, kayaking, and beachcombing. On a natural beach on the “Forgotten Coast” of the Gulf of Mexico far from crowds and commercialization, the area around St. Teresa provides one of the most diverse eco-systems in North America. You may see dolphins, manatees, the exotic local white squirrels, and even the occasional Florida black bear, not to mention every kind of shore bird you can imagine.

I was fortunate enough to spend the best parts of every summer at St. Teresa with my Tallahassee grandparents who built a little cottage here in the 1920's. No matter how the world was changing, the beauty and serenity of St. Teresa remained a constant in the lives of me and my family.
